Ok. As hard as it is, I need a truck for winter and the love of my life for the past 4 years has to go. The specs.

2001 Mustang Cobra Laser Red 5 speed with 66-69k on the odo (can't remember exactly). It has the two tone tan/suede leather interior, which is in incredible condition. It has 4.10 gears, BBK O/R Xpipe, flowmaster catback exhaust, and a short throw shifter. It's currently in the shop, having a re manufactured Jasper motor put in, which comes with a 3 year/100k mile warranty. It has the 03/04 front bumper and hood, as well as the 03/04 satin rims, with 275's all the way around. The 2 front tires are going to need replaced soon, 1 of the rear tires is brand new due to running over some screws and having to replace it, and the other rear is about 30 or 40% tread. They're all Goodyear DSG-1's if I remember correctly. The stock springs were cut so it sits lower. 20% tint all the way around, and a shorty antenna. It also has the stock radio in it, 6 disk cd changer and Cobra floor mats (the ones in the picture are old).

The body is in incredible shape, with brand new paint from last year and no rust anywhere. The bad? It has a salvage title, I had an accident in it back in 08, with drivers side damage and had it rebuilt at an incredible shop up in PA. The guy who rebuilt it does great work, and you can never tell it was wrecked. It tracks straight, and has no issues whatsoever, and the entire car was repainted except for the rear bumper and spoiler/trunk. The spoiler has white marks on it, from the paint peeling or something. I can provide pictures of the damage when it was wrecked upon request. There are also a few nicks in the hood now, from rocks.
